Background:
MLXIP Antibody: MLXIP is a member of the Myc superfamily of transcription factors and functions as part of a heterodimer with Max-like protein X (MLX) to activate transcription (1). MLXIP contributes to the regulation of glucose homeostasis as the MLXIP/MLX heterodimer activates expression of thioredoxin-interacting protein (TXNIP), a potent inhibitor of cellular glucose uptake and aerobic glycolysis. The mammalian target of rapamycin (mTOR) suppresses the activation of the TXNIP pathway by binding to MLXIP, thereby preventing the MLXIP/MLX heterodimer formation (2). MLXIP interaction with Myc may also be involved in metabolic reprogramming and tumorigenesis (3).
